What does a major account executive do?

A major account executive is responsible for handling client accounts and ensuring that their project requirements are met accordingly by following budget limitations and timetables. Major account executives determine strategic techniques to improve the client's brand image on the market and record progress based on the project's milestones. They also coordinate with the marketing and sales team to establish efficient campaigns and monitor sales performance. A major account executive conducts data and statistical analysis by evaluating the current market trends to identify opportunities that would generate more revenue resources and increase profitability.

What does a sales/account representative do?

A sales account representative is responsible for managing and responding promptly to customer complaints and queries of clients. They focus on customer concerns and contact prospects. They work on upselling or cross-selling products and services, collaborating with account executives, and prepare reports to upper management. This job requires you to be a goal-driven person, energetic, and have excellent communication skills. Moreover, this is a challenging job; at times, it requires being extra polite and calm in handling customer complaints and other related situations.
